It is forgotten that many men did not have the vote in the UK either. Some facts:-
Reform Act 1832:- Resulted in 15% males having the vote.
Representation of the People Act 1884:- Increased suffrage but still 40% of men could not vote.
Representation of the People Act 1918:- Universal suffrage for males over 21, females over 30.
Representation of the People Act 1928 - Universal suffrage all over 21.
In photos the policemen arresting the suffragettes did not have the vote either.
